I think a decent beginners rule is that if you are going to risk all your stack in level 1-2 (providing you havent been crippled) you want at least top pair top kicker.

Gladly shoving all your chips in the middle with crap or because you have a hunch etc will just get you in trouble. People pay you off often enough when you do have a decent hand that you don't need to go out on these fishing expiditions.
